Web26 Jan 2016 · By Diana Divecha January 26, 2016. When I was a child, my parents’ fights could suck the oxygen out of a room. My mother verbally lashed my father, smashed jam jars, and made outlandish threats. Her outbursts froze me in my tracks. Toxic parents treat children like adults. Web4 Apr 2024 · Here are the main cons of joint custody. 1. Exact 50/50 custody is disruptive for very young children. For very young children, exact 50/50 custody makes for a disrupted life. Have a look at the top-rated 50/50 custody schedule for a baby for example. It requires 12 trips between homes per fortnight.
